The requirement for differing grid sizes has been requested previously. However, there is an alternative in this case. All objects can be displayed in one of 5 different sizes, as shown on this screenshot:
GenoPro defaults to the size 'Medium' for entry (perhaps this could be changed in the Options?), but the size is easily changed by selecting the objects and using the highlighted buttons on the toolbar. I'm sure 'Large' or 'Extra Large' would meet your requirements.

I have to say that I really like the auto-arrange and that more often than not it does what I want it to do. I've got a family tree with 520 or so people and there are probably less than 20 of those where the auto-arrange doesn't do what I want, and only 1 situation where it makes a right hash of it (one of my ancestors married her late husband's uncle). But it is so easy when adding new people to the tree to just click the auto-arrange that I use it all the time and put up with the deficiencies. It would be great if you could do a selected auto-arrange. That way you could highlight the people just added, and the auto-arrange would only move them around. Alternatively, if you could group people together in such a way that the auto-arrange handled them as a single object you could then manually arrange the "problem" people and group them together knowing that next time you clicked the auto-arrange button they wouldn't be affected. I think what you want is already in place, Select a group of people and the top line of tools is no longer greyed out but shows AutoArrange Selection
